AMD Hits Major Milestone with TSMC N2 Product Silicon Achievement

AMD has reached a significant milestone in its collaboration with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company (TSMC), achieving the first product silicon milestone for the N2 process. This breakthrough marks a crucial step forward in the development of next-generation semiconductor products, further solidifying AMD's position as a leader in the tech industry. According to a recent report by Yahoo Finance, this achievement is a testament to the strength of the partnership between AMD and TSMC.

What is TSMC N2 Process?

The TSMC N2 process is a cutting-edge semiconductor manufacturing technology that offers improved performance, power efficiency, and density compared to its predecessors. This advanced process node is designed to support the production of high-performance computing products, including central processing units (CPUs), graphics processing units (GPUs), and other specialized chips. The N2 process is expected to play a critical role in enabling the development of next-generation technologies, such as artificial intelligence, 5G, and the Internet of Things (IoT).
